区块链技术自从被提出以来,便以其安全性、透明性和去中心化等优点引起了广泛关注。其中,区块链钱包作为用户与区块链网络之间的重要桥梁,其钱包地址的管理和使用显得尤为重要。在使用区块链钱包进行交易时,钱包地址的清晰与易读性关乎到用户的体验与安全性。关于“区块链钱包地址可以自定义吗?”这一问题,许多人对此产生了浓厚的兴趣。本文将对这一问题进行深入探讨,并重点关注区块链钱包地址的构造、运作机制及其自定义的可能性与应用场景。
区块链钱包地址实际上是用户在区块链网络上进行交易时的唯一标识符。每个钱包都有一组公钥和私钥,其中公钥通常用于生成钱包地址。钱包地址是由公钥经过哈希运算后生成的一串字符,常见的形式包括以1、3或bc1开头的地址。它的作用类似于银行账户号码,用户通过该地址可以接收和发送加密货币。
区块链上的每个钱包地址都与特定的资产绑定,这种绑定可以通过智能合约等形式实现。这样,不同的加密货币和不同的钱包地址都有着清晰的对应关系,使得交易能够有效并安全地进行。
生成区块链钱包地址的过程涉及多个步骤及算法。最常见的算法是使用椭圆曲线数字签名算法(ECDSA),它可以保证钱包地址的唯一性与安全性。首先,用户生成一组密钥对(私钥、公钥),然后通过哈希函数对公钥进行多次变换,得到标准格式的钱包地址。在这些变换中,哈希的作用在于增加地址生成的随机性与复杂性,从而确保钱包的安全性。
虽然钱包地址在数字上是由特定的算法生成的,但用户在使用中可以对某些类型的地址进行一定的自定义。例如,某些平台或钱包允许用户选择偏好的命名或标签来标识特定的地址,以增加识别的便利性。但在数字意义上,这些地址仍会保持为原有自动生成的格式。
关于“区块链钱包地址可以自定义吗?”的核心问题在于,用户在实际操作中能否直接修改或定义一个钱包地址。一般而言,传统的加密货币钱包地址是无法被直接自定义的,因为其本质上是通过算法生成的字符组合,不支持用户进行人工干预。
不过,在一些属于更高级应用场景中,某些钱包平台可能会提供“别名”功能,用户可以为自己的钱包地址设置易记的昵称或标识,这并不影响地址的原始格式,同时为用户操作带来了便利。不过,实际上,这种方便的方式并不能改变区块链的基本特性与原理。
虽然一些钱包尝试为用户提供自定义地址的选择,但我们必须意识到,这种做法可能带来安全隐患。由于区块链的去中心化特性,没有人能够保证钱包地址的绝对安全性。因此,任何形式的自定义都可能为黑客攻击提供更大的空间。
此外,某些非官方的自定义钱包地址可能较难追踪其资金流向,可能会用来进行洗钱等非法活动。这也就说明,在使用自定义地址时,用户需要时刻保持警惕,确保安全与合规。
管理区块链钱包地址安全的根本在于保障私钥的安全。私钥是用户控制其钱包的唯一凭证,若私钥泄露,钱包中的资产将可能被盗取。因此,用户应采取以下措施确保安全:
通过始终保持警惕、定期更新和审核个人安全措施,用户可以更好地管理和保护自己的区块链钱包地址及其资产。
区块链的去中心化特性虽然保障了用户隐私,但这与实际身份的关联性依然值得关注。在某些区块链服务中,用户可能需要通过KYC(了解你的客户)程序来验证身份,从而使得用户的钱包地址与其真实身份有所关联。例如,在交易所进行法币交易时,往往需要用户提供身份证明。
虽然区块链交易记录是公开透明的,任何人都可以追踪到钱包地址的交易历史,但由于钱包地址本身无法直接识别用户身份,因此在真正意义上保护用户隐私的建议是,不要将个人身份信息直接与钱包地址相关联。用户还可以选择使用匿名币如门罗币(Monero)进行隐私保护。
毫无疑问,用户可以使用多个区块链钱包地址来进行资产管理。实际上,许多用户采用多钱包策略来分散风险、提高安全性或管理不同资产。这种方式不仅有效降低单一钱包被攻击的风险,同时在不同钱包之间保持资产的灵活性也十分重要。
不过,使用多个钱包地址时也需要注意记录相关信息,如销毁未用的地址、不定期审计各个钱包的交易历史及资产状况等。通过妥善的管理和安排用户才能确保其数字货币资产的安全。
选择适合的区块链钱包是一个至关重要的决策。在选择时,你需要考虑多个方面:
通过综合考虑以上各项,用户可以更好地选择出适合自己的区块链钱包,以便在日常交易中保证其资产的安全和便捷流动。
综上所述,虽然区块链钱包地址本身无法直接自定义,但通过相关技术手段与功能设置,用户依旧可以根据自身需求进行一定的管理。希望通过本文的信息与解答,能够给予广大用户在使用区块链钱包时更多的帮助与指导。